Breo Ellipta’s generic name (active ingredients) is fluticasone furoate and vilanterol [1].
Breo Ellipta is a combination inhaler that includes: - Fluticasone furoate (an inhaled corticosteroid) - Vilanterol (a long-acting beta2-agonist, LABA) [1]
Breo Ellipta is a brand name, not the generic name. The generic name refers to the two active ingredients: fluticasone furoate + vilanterol [1].
